Senin, 31 Mei 2010

antara hidup dan pemrograman

hidup itu tidak lebih dari potongan baris-baris program.

Dimulai disaat qta mengawali sesuatu. qta memualai dengan membuat perencanaan atau membuat visi dan misi. Dalam dunia pemrograman itu diimplementasikan dalam bentuk bahasa-bahasa pemodelan atau biasa disebut bussines process.

konsep manusia yang tidak dapat hidup sendiri, selalu ingin berinteraksi, sosialisasi juga dapat tidak lepas dari potongan baris-baris program. konsep tersebut biasa disebut dengan pendeklarasian variabel, atau instansiasi.

operator logika pada pemrograman berfungsi layaknya otak kiri pada manusia. bagian inilah yang memperhatikan segala kemungkian yang terjadi. jika begini... maka begitu, jika begitu... maka begini :). segala macam perhitungan dilakukan disini.

keanekaragaman manusia yang memiliki karakter yang berbeda-beda, kondisi fisik yang berbeda-beda, kemampuan yang berbeda-beda juga tidak luput dari kemiripannya dengan gaya pemrograman (gaya pemrograma modern atau biasa disebut Object Oriented Programming). dimana suatu kumpulan code-code program dibungkus sehingga memiliki karakteristik seperti property, method, fungsi, prosedur, dll.

lalu apa yang qta(manusia) bisa pelajari dari pemrograman???
dalam bahasa pemrograman dikenal isitilah TRY... CATCH..cara ini bekerja dengan mengangkap kegagalan yang dihasilkan oleh potongan-potongan program sebelumnya dan kemudian menyimpannya ke dalam memori. setelah kegagalan disimpan, pengeksekusian baris program akan dilanjutkan ke baris-baris berikutnya. secara garis besar potongan baris program itu bertujuan mengantisipasi kegagalan yang terjadi. hal ini yang sebagian besar dari qta(manusia) tidak miliki. qta menjalani sesuatu secara prosedural. dan disaat suatu hambatan menghentikan langkah kita, kita akan berhenti tanpa mencoba melihat hambatannya.
marilah qta mencoba melihat apa hambatan yang terjadi, melakukan perbaikan, dan kemudian mencoba lagi. :)

blog ini saya tulis dalam upaya untuk melakukan perbaikan diri agar menjadi lebih baik. terima kasih.